If you’ve forgotten your password and can’t remember or access the answer to your security question, visit the Gmail sign-in page and click on “Forgot password?”

Google will guide you through a recovery process, which may include sending a verification code to your recovery email address or phone number if you’ve linked one previously.

If those recovery options are also unavailable, click on “Try another way” to explore additional recovery methods. You may be asked to verify your identity by answering a series of questions regarding your account activity, such as when you created the Gmail account, frequently used contacts, or past email subjects.

Be as accurate as possible in your answers, as this helps Google verify that you are the rightful owner of the account. In cases where none of the recovery options work, you can fill out the account recovery form with all the details you remember.

Google uses this information to assess ownership and, if verified, will send instructions to reset your password. It’s also helpful to use a familiar device and location when attempting recovery, as this strengthens the authenticity of your request.

Once you regain access, update your recovery phone and email, and set up 2-Step Verification to better secure your account in the future. If the automated tools fail, unfortunately, Google does not offer live support for free Gmail accounts, so persistence and detailed answers in the recovery form are crucial.

Being proactive about keeping recovery details updated is the best way to avoid losing access in the future.
